WebPalmar erythema (red palms of hands) also occurs commonly in chronic liver disease. Bruising and bleeding Patients with chronic liver disease often experience increased bleeding from the gums and mouth and easy bruising. This is primarily related to abnormal clotting of blood caused by a reduced ability of the liver to synthesise clotting factors.

Webgenerally feeling unwell and tired all the time. loss of appetite. loss of weight and muscle wasting. feeling sick (nausea) and vomiting. tenderness/pain in the liver area. spider-like … Web2. feb 2024 · Red palms are also known as palmar erythema, or liver palms, and the reddening typically occurs on the lower part of the palm. The redness in the palms is caused by dilated capillaries in the hands which draw more blood to the surface. The degree of redness can vary depending on: Temperature Pressure applied to your hands Your …
